| Package | Description | 
|---|---|
| net.minecraft.client.resources | |
| net.minecraft.client.resources.data | 
| Modifier and Type | Field and Description | 
|---|---|
| private java.util.Map<java.lang.String,IMetadataSection> | SimpleResource. mapMetadataSections | 
| Modifier and Type | Method and Description | 
|---|---|
| <T extends IMetadataSection> | SimpleResource. getMetadata(java.lang.String sectionName) | 
| <T extends IMetadataSection> | IResource. getMetadata(java.lang.String sectionName) | 
| <T extends IMetadataSection> | LegacyV2Adapter. getPackMetadata(MetadataSerializer metadataSerializer,
               java.lang.String metadataSectionName) | 
| <T extends IMetadataSection> | AbstractResourcePack. getPackMetadata(MetadataSerializer metadataSerializer,
               java.lang.String metadataSectionName) | 
| <T extends IMetadataSection> | DefaultResourcePack. getPackMetadata(MetadataSerializer metadataSerializer,
               java.lang.String metadataSectionName) | 
| <T extends IMetadataSection> | IResourcePack. getPackMetadata(MetadataSerializer metadataSerializer,
               java.lang.String metadataSectionName) | 
| (package private) static <T extends IMetadataSection> | AbstractResourcePack. readMetadata(MetadataSerializer metadataSerializer,
            java.io.InputStream p_110596_1_,
            java.lang.String sectionName) | 
| Modifier and Type | Class and Description | 
|---|---|
| class  | BaseMetadataSectionSerializer<T extends IMetadataSection> | 
| interface  | IMetadataSectionSerializer<T extends IMetadataSection> | 
| (package private) class  | MetadataSerializer.Registration<T extends IMetadataSection> | 
| Modifier and Type | Class and Description | 
|---|---|
| class  | AnimationMetadataSection | 
| class  | FontMetadataSection | 
| class  | LanguageMetadataSection | 
| class  | PackMetadataSection | 
| class  | TextureMetadataSection | 
| Modifier and Type | Field and Description | 
|---|---|
| private IRegistry<java.lang.String,MetadataSerializer.Registration<? extends IMetadataSection>> | MetadataSerializer. metadataSectionSerializerRegistry | 
| Modifier and Type | Method and Description | 
|---|---|
| <T extends IMetadataSection> | MetadataSerializer. parseMetadataSection(java.lang.String sectionName,
                    com.google.gson.JsonObject json) | 
| <T extends IMetadataSection> | MetadataSerializer. registerMetadataSectionType(IMetadataSectionSerializer<T> metadataSectionSerializer,
                           java.lang.Class<T> clazz) |